Output 8b69855d4e5de59bfba2a46b7717cc924bb83656341c2719d32083fb139d2268:3

value
17340463
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 859c1920f35d1c2ae531c7f5c045b8ee7eead473 OP_EQUALVERIFY OP_CHECKSIG
address
1DBTsQQyDFyZGSaCAwyjjJZ8JrQ6UsYPcD
transaction
8b69855d4e5de59bfba2a46b7717cc924bb83656341c2719d32083fb139d2268
spent
true